Neil Diamond
Neil Diamond tickets have been the envy of music fans since his performance at the Greek Theatre in Los Angeles in 1970. Before then, his brilliant songs were selling tickets for the Monkees, Elvis, and Deep Purple. His songs finally sold Diamond tickets after the recorded live performance proved that he was a personable singer who had a magnetic personality to go with those brilliant lyrics.
The trip from fencing and biology to singing before millions of fans began in high school. He was about to go to medical school, but at the last second he was offered $50 a week to write songs at the famed Brill Building. Eventually his desire to sell Neil Diamond tickets instead of Neil Diamond lyrics thrusted him out of the writers' room and onto the stage. His name appeared on tickets, but as the opening act for groups like Herman's Hermit and The Who.
The live album, Hot August Night, saved him from the label's axe. Throughout the ‘80s he tried to compose songs fro movies, but his albums outsold the box office and the collection of soundtracks became a staple at concerts and on world tours. Diamond tickets were a strong draw as he covered his hits made famous by others, sang his original recordings, and belted material from Hollywood's flops.
